Output 734648f156774f771c6b753d08901032a9036999239e089123eda1affd0fa0db:0

value
18709317
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3f04d610067ad97468f19e0ff7579d9a42ee9438 OP_EQUAL
address
MDeNbYEXxnnbf9G8HY3HMijz78jQCNcvWD
transaction
734648f156774f771c6b753d08901032a9036999239e089123eda1affd0fa0db
spent
true